Ginger Pumpkin Mousse - A Light, Fluffy Alternative To Pumpkin Pie
Say goodbye to the same old pumpkin pie. I am shaking up tradition with a scrumptious twist - Ginger Pumpkin Mousse. With a hint of orange and a pop of crystalized ginger, it's the star dessert for any time of year.
For an even bigger twist, pour the mousse into a premade pie shell and have a no-bake pumpkin mousse pie.
=== ???????????? RECIPE ===
4 large egg yolks
2 tablespoons rum (light or dark)
2 1/2 ounces (70g) granulated sugar
4 ounces (120ml) pulp free orange juice
1 - 15 ounce (425g) can of pumpkin
2 teaspoons pumpkin pie spice
Pinch fine salt
2 1/2 ounces (70g) crystallized ginger, finely chopped
16 ounces (480ml) heavy cream
Using a wire whisk, beat the egg yolks, sugar, rum, and orange juice in a large, heat proof bowl until light and foamy (about 30 seconds). Put about 1 inch (2cm) of water in a saucepan and simmer over medium heat. Set the bowl over the water and whisk until the eggs thicken (3-4 minutes, or less if you use an electric hand mixer).
Remove the bowl from the heat. Add the pumpkin, spice and salt. Continue to whisk until the mixture is cooled. Once cooled, stir in half the ginger.
Whip the cream in another bowl or stand mixer until it forms stiff peaks (Don't overwhip or you'll get butter!) Fold the whipped cream into the pumpkin mixture until combined.
Cover with plastic wrap and chill for at least 2 to 24 hours.
Serving suggestion #:1 Sprinkle shaved chocolate or pieces of crystalized ginger over the mousse before serving.
Serving Suggestion #2: Pour it into a premade pie shell, and you have a pumpkin mousse pie.

The Best Fluffy Pumpkin Cheesecake
This is the best pumpkin cheesecake. Every year, my family requests that I make this cheesecake to our family gatherings.
2 packages (8oz. each) cream cheese, softened
2/3 cup sugar
1 1/2 teaspoon pumpkin pie spice
2 eggs
1 can (15oz) pumpkin puree
1 Keebler Ready Crust Extra serving Size Pie Crust
1. In a large mixing bowl beat cream cheese on medium speed of electric mixer until fluffy. Add sugar and spice. Beat until combined.
2. Add eggs, one at a time, mixing until combined after each addition.
3. Stir in pumpkin.
4. Pour into crust. Bake at 350 degrees for 45 min or until center is almost set.
5. Cool for 1 hour then refrigerate at least 3 hours.
6. Garnish with whipped cream.
Soft & Fluffy Pumpkin Doughnut Bites Recipe | The Sweetest Journey
How to make donut bites with pumpkin and covered with cinnamon-sugar.
Ingredients:
1/2 Cup Sugar (96g)
1 Teaspoon Pumpkin Pie Spice (1.85g)
5 Tablespoons Melted Butter (75ml)
1/2 Cup Milk (120ml)
1/2 Cup Pumpkin Puree (123g)
1 Cup Flour (136g)
1 Teaspoon Baking Powder (5g)
Coating:
1/2 Cup Sugar (96g)
1 Teaspoon Cinnamon (2g)
1/4 Cup Melted Butter (60ml)
Directions:
1. In a mixing bowl, whisk together the sugar, pumpkin pie spice, and melted butter until well combined. Stir in the milk. Stir in the pumpkin puree. Add the flour and baking powder and mix just until combined. Grease a mini muffin tin with cooking spray or butter. Spoon 1 tablespoon of batter into each cup. Bake in a preheated oven at 375F for 15 minutes or until an inserted toothpick comes out clean. Let stand in pan 10 minutes, then remove to a wire rack and cool completely.
2. In a small bowl, whisk together the cinnamon and sugar. Put the melted butter in another small bowl. Dip each doughnut bite in the melted butter, then roll in the cinnamon sugar.
| Makes 24 Doughnut Bites
